can a compartmental canndidate who have scored 75% marks in 10+2 exam , eligible to appear before the Neet Exam 2021

ADITYA KUMAR Student Expert 14th Jul, 2021

Hi

Yes ,you are eligible for neet 2021 even if you have given compartment examination provided you should have cleared your compartment examination and after clearing it , you must have got :-

  • at least  50  % in aggregate of PCB  i.e Physics, Chemistry and Biology/Biotechnology  in 12th examination  if belongs to general category

  • at least  40%  in aggregate of PCB if belongs to  Obc/ Sc /st category

  • at least 45 % in aggregate of PCB in case of pwd candidates to be eligible .

so ,if you meet this percentage requirement in PCB as per your category then you are eligible for Neet examination.

Also,

* to be eligible for neet 2021 one has to be at least 17 years old or more by 31st December 2021

* There is no upper age limit for Neet 2021

* There's no limit for the maximum number of attempts/times one can appear in NEET.
